📚About the Program
Southwest University (SWU), founded in 2005, is located in Chongqing, China, nestled at the foot of Jinyun Mountain and alongside the scenic Jialing River. As a national key comprehensive university, SWU is recognized for its expansive 600-hectare garden-style campus and its excellence in disciplines such as education, psychology, and agronomy, particularly noted for its leading research in silkworm genomics.
The Master’s in Animal Genetics, Breeding and Reproduction program offers students in-depth knowledge and practical skills in animal genetics and reproductive technologies. Students will engage with advanced topics in genetic improvement and breeding strategies, preparing them for careers in research, agriculture, and animal production sectors. The program's unique blend of theoretical foundations and hands-on experience equips graduates to address contemporary challenges in animal genetics and enhance livestock production systems.
